Bug Description

Double Asterisk to Bold doesn't work.

How to Reproduce

Open/Create a document. When trying to bold text using **TEXT_TO_BOLD** , it doesn't become bold.

Expected Behavior

The text between two asterisk should become bold.

Operating System

Windows 11

AppFlowy Version(s)

Version 0.1.1 (1)

@Xazin commented on GitHub (Mar 23, 2023):

I will presume that all these "markdown" formatters, aka. keyboard commands that insert text and expect to be handled correctly, will suffer from the keyboard layout issue until we have a solution for text commands.

@LucasXu0 commented on GitHub (Mar 24, 2023):

I re-think your previous suggestion, adding a text command for input_service. And here's my idea, we can both support key event commands, like shift+slash, shift+enter, and support character commands, like /, *.

Screenshot 2023-03-24 at 10 06 53

As the above screenshot shows, the onKey callback also returns the character. So, I think can extend this function to support different keyboard types.
